formatting/spelling
authorJoerg Jaspert <joerg@debian.org>
Tue, 23 Apr 2013 13:33:49 +0000 (15:33 +0200)
committerJoerg Jaspert <joerg@debian.org>
Tue, 23 Apr 2013 13:33:49 +0000 (15:33 +0200)
.emacs.d/config/emacs.org

index 84ea62f..d6d4145 100644 (file)
@@ -168,33 +168,33 @@ below.
 The following functions are used throughout my config, and so I load
 them first.
 
-safe-load does not break emacs initialization, should a file be
-  unreadable while emacs boots up.
-  #+BEGIN_SRC emacs-lisp
-    (defvar safe-load-error-list ""
-            "*List of files that reported errors when loaded via safe-load")
-
-    (defun safe-load (file &optional noerror nomessage nosuffix)
-      "Load a file.  If error on load, report back, wait for
-       a key stroke then continue on"
-      (interactive "f")
-      (condition-case nil (load file noerror nomessage nosuffix)
-        (error
-          (progn
-           (setq safe-load-error-list  (concat safe-load-error-list  " " file))
-           (message "****** [Return to continue] Error loading %s" safe-load-error-list )
-            (sleep-for 1)
-           nil))))
-
-    (defun safe-load-check ()
-     "Check for any previous safe-load loading errors.  (safe-load.el)"
-      (interactive)
-      (if (string-equal safe-load-error-list "") ()
-                   (message (concat "****** error loading: " safe-load-error-list))))
-#+END_SRC
-
-match-paren will either jump to the "other" paren or simply insert %
-  #+BEGIN_SRC emacs-lisp
+safe-load does not break emacs initialization, should a file be
+unreadable while emacs boots up.
+#+BEGIN_SRC emacs-lisp
+  (defvar safe-load-error-list ""
+          "*List of files that reported errors when loaded via safe-load")
+
+  (defun safe-load (file &optional noerror nomessage nosuffix)
+    "Load a file.  If error on load, report back, wait for
+     a key stroke then continue on"
+    (interactive "f")
+    (condition-case nil (load file noerror nomessage nosuffix)
+      (error
+        (progn
+         (setq safe-load-error-list  (concat safe-load-error-list  " " file))
+         (message "****** [Return to continue] Error loading %s" safe-load-error-list )
+          (sleep-for 1)
+         nil))))
+
+  (defun safe-load-check ()
+   "Check for any previous safe-load loading errors.  (safe-load.el)"
+    (interactive)
+    (if (string-equal safe-load-error-list "") ()
+                 (message (concat "****** error loading: " safe-load-error-list))))
+#+END_SRC
+
+match-paren will either jump to the "other" paren or simply insert %
+#+BEGIN_SRC emacs-lisp
 (defun match-paren (arg)
   "Go to the matching parenthesis if on parenthesis otherwise insert %."
   (interactive "p")
@@ -203,20 +203,20 @@ them first.
         (t (self-insert-command (or arg 1)))))
   #+END_SRC
 
-Always ensure to have a scratch buffer around.
-  #+BEGIN_SRC emacs-lisp
-  (save-excursion
+Always ensure to have a scratch buffer around.
+#+BEGIN_SRC emacs-lisp
+(save-excursion
     (set-buffer (get-buffer-create "*scratch*"))
     (lisp-interaction-mode)
     (make-local-variable 'kill-buffer-query-functions)
     (add-hook 'kill-buffer-query-functions 'kill-scratch-buffer))
-  #+END_SRC
+#+END_SRC
 
-Helpers for the config
-  #+BEGIN_SRC emacs-lisp
-  (require 'use-package)
-  (require 'bind-key)
-  #+END_SRC
+Helpers for the config
+#+BEGIN_SRC emacs-lisp
+(require 'use-package)
+(require 'bind-key)
+#+END_SRC
 
 ** Path settings
 *** Load path
@@ -283,7 +283,7 @@ And it is nice to have a final newline in files.
 #+END_SRC
 
 After I typed 300 characters or took a break for more than a minute it
-would be nice of emacs to save whatever I am on in one of his auto-save
+would be nice of emacs to save whatever I am on in one of its auto-save
 backups. See [[info:emacs#Auto%20Save%20Control][info:emacs#Auto Save Control]] for more details.
 #+BEGIN_SRC emacs-lisp
 (setq auto-save-interval 300)
@@ -329,21 +329,22 @@ most for my shells, in Emacs Inconsolata clearly wins.
 #+END_SRC
 
 And I always liked dark backgrounds with colors setup for them. So I
-had a theme doing it in emacs too, but never entirely liked it. Until I
-found solarized, which is now not only my emacs theme, but also for
-most of my other software too, especially my shell. Consistent look is great.
+switched through multiple themes doing it in emacs too, but never
+entirely liked it. Until I found solarized, which is now not only my
+emacs theme, but also for most of my other software too, especially my
+shell. Consistent look is great.
 #+BEGIN_SRC emacs-lisp
   (add-to-list 'custom-theme-load-path "~/elisp/emacs-color-theme-solarized")
   (setq solarized-termcolors 16)
   (load-theme 'solarized-dark t)
 #+END_SRC
 
-
 Make the fringe (gutter) smaller, the argument is a width in pixels (the default is 8)
 #+BEGIN_SRC emacs-lisp
 (if (fboundp 'fringe-mode)
     (fringe-mode 4))
 #+END_SRC
+
 *** Turn the cursor blinking off
 [2013-04-21 So 20:54]
 #+BEGIN_SRC emacs-lisp